C63800 Bronze vs. EN 1.7710 Steel

C63800 bronze belongs to the copper alloys classification, while EN 1.7710 steel belongs to the iron alloys. There are 25 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(10,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is C63800 bronze and the bottom bar is EN 1.7710 steel.
